Slot 9 has SSL Module WS-SVC-SSL 1 SAD081200NF
Log says:
Apr 20 11:52:51: %OIR-SP-3-PWRCYCLE: Card in module 9, is being power-cycled off (Module not responding to Keep Alive polling)
Is there a way of connecting to the SSL module in slot 9 and getting any CRASHINFO file from the SSL module or some such thing to see why this module did not respond or do I have to connect a console directly to SSL module console port?
Appears like issue in CSCdz21419 but we are already running IOS 12.2(17a)SX1 which fixes this issue.
